Output f14454913822cc08c0d75829e4e02ad62464ea3a318f225539310a74a6bfe103:2

value
37066273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c594e629993683b0ee01ad57b9505595f7ee2a1f OP_EQUAL
address
MRusiuiTXHEdE3v6LviXd6XLQaWdX2Lucx
transaction
f14454913822cc08c0d75829e4e02ad62464ea3a318f225539310a74a6bfe103
spent
true